Digital Battle: GTA 4: The Ballad of Gay Tony Review

Digital Battle writes: "The second and final episode of Grand Theft Auto 4, The Ballad of Gay Tony, has been released, and with it, Rockstar closes the curtain for GTA 4 with a bang. The episode is being released exclusive on the Xbox 360, either as a standalone download, or as a part of the "Episodes of Liberty City" retail expansion pack, which also includes the previous episode, The Lost and Damned."
